Advanced critical care is performed by experienced nurses and other appropriate healthcare professionals in collaboration with local health services.
Advanced Critical Care Practitioners can fulfil roles as clinicians, managers, leaders and educators in the context of advanced practice.
Practitioners typically work in partnership with patients, families and other professionals to provide the highest standard of healthcare.

About this course
Already working in a critical care environment.
A first degree in a health related disc.ipline.
At least five years’ post-registration critical care experience.
Have the full support of a line manager and/ or consultant(s) who will act as mentor(s) during the course.
